Is the Kylebooker Men Running Vest a Good Value for Fishing Enthusiasts?

For fishing enthusiasts, having the right gear is essential for both comfort and performance. While traditional fishing vests are popular, many anglers are now exploring multipurpose outerwear like the Kylebooker Men Running Vest. Marketed as a sleeveless military-style jacket suitable for hiking, running, and fishing, this vest promises versatility and durability. But does it deliver good value for money? Let’s break down its features, pros, and cons to determine whether it’s a worthwhile investment.

Design and Material
The Kylebooker vest is designed with a lightweight, breathable fabric, making it ideal for outdoor activities in warm weather. Its sleeveless military-inspired cut ensures freedom of movement, which is crucial for casting and reeling. The material is typically a blend of polyester and spandex, offering quick-drying properties—an advantage if you’re fishing near water or in humid conditions.

Storage and Functionality
One of the key selling points for anglers is storage. This vest features multiple pockets, including zippered compartments and mesh sections, allowing for organized gear storage. While it may not have as many specialized fishing pockets as a dedicated fishing vest, the ample space can accommodate tackle boxes, pliers, a small net, or even a hydration pack for long fishing trips.

The military-style design also includes MOLLE webbing, which adds modularity. You can attach additional pouches or accessories, customizing the vest based on your needs. This feature is particularly useful for anglers who carry varying amounts of gear depending on the fishing style (e.g., fly fishing vs. baitcasting).

Comfort and Fit
A good fishing vest should be comfortable for extended wear. The Kylebooker vest is adjustable with side straps, ensuring a snug fit without restricting movement. The breathable mesh lining helps with ventilation, preventing overheating during active fishing sessions. However, some users note that the sizing can run slightly large, so checking the size chart before purchasing is advisable.

Durability and Weather Resistance
While not fully waterproof, the fabric is water-resistant to some degree, protecting against light rain or splashes. Reinforced stitching enhances durability, though heavy-duty fishing use may test its long-term resilience. If you frequently fish in rough conditions, a specialized fishing vest with reinforced padding might be a better choice.

Price and Value
Compared to high-end fishing vests, the Kylebooker vest is relatively affordable, often priced under $50. Its multipurpose design means you can use it beyond fishing—for hiking, running, or even casual wear—adding to its value. However, if you prioritize fishing-specific features like rod holders or waterproof pockets, a dedicated fishing vest might justify a higher price.

Final Verdict
The Kylebooker Men Running Vest offers solid value for casual anglers who want a lightweight, versatile option. Its storage capacity, comfort, and modular design make it a practical choice for warm-weather fishing. However, serious anglers who need specialized features may find it lacking.

Pros:
✔ Lightweight and breathable
✔ Multiple pockets and MOLLE compatibility
✔ Affordable compared to dedicated fishing vests
✔ Suitable for other outdoor activities

Cons:
✖ Not fully waterproof
✖ Less specialized than premium fishing vests
✖ Sizing may be inconsistent

If you’re looking for a budget-friendly, multipurpose vest that performs decently for fishing, the Kylebooker vest is worth considering. But if fishing is your primary focus, investing in a specialized vest with enhanced durability and functionality may be the better long-term choice.
